A device that is semi-permanently attached to the ankle of someone who is under
house arrest. The device communicates with a monitor installed in the wearer's home which sends a signal to the
probation officer if it is not within a short distance from the monitor at specific times of the day. Typically used during
level 4 probation to ensure that the wearer stays at home during prescribed hours.
